REPHRASING PRESENT PERFECT

PRESENT PERFECT

1. FORM: present of have+ past participle

Examples:

You have seen that film many times / She has seen that film many times

Have you seen that film many times?/ Has she seen that film many times?

You have not seen that film many times. / She has not seen that film many times

1. b. USE: We use the present perfect to express


1. 1. Recent past with present result – the action is finished but it has an influence on the
present, it puts emphasis on the result, and it always suggests a relationship between present time
and past time.

Examples:

I’ve had breakfast( implies that I did so very recently)

She has just arrived from London

She has already arrived from London

Has she arrived from London yet? / She hasn’t arrived from London yet

She has recently arrived from London

She has arrived from London today/this week/ this morning

Time expressions:

Just ð before the main verb in affirmative sentences

Already ð before the main verb in affirmative sentences

Yet ð at the end in interrogative and negative sentences

recently, lately ð before the main verb or at the end in affirmative sentences

today/these days

this morning/ week/month/year…

1. 2. Actions or situations that started in the past and continue up to the present– The action or
the period of time has not finished.
Examples:

I have studied at this school for five years (I came five years ago and I’m still studying here)

I have studied at this school since 2003 (I came in 2003 and I’m still studying here)

She has written 18 e-mails so far this morning (She may have finished writing e-mails but we are still in this
morning)

He hasn’t appeared on TV before now /up till now/ up to the present

Time expressions:

For + period of time ð I have lived here for eight years

Since+ point of timeð I have lived here since 2000 / I have lived here since I was seven

So far/before now/ up till now / up to now/ up to the present

1. 3. Past experiences without a specific time reference to the past -actions that have taken place
once, never or several times before the moment of speaking

Examples:

Have you ever been to Australia? I have never been to Australia

She has always worked hard She has attended classes regularly

I have been to Australia twice/several times He has often visited his grandparents

Time expressions:

Everð questions

Neverð affirmative

Frequency adverbs: always/regularly/often / frequently…

Once, twice, three times…, several times/ It’s the first time

REPHRASING

Present Perfect and Past Simple:

1. I haven’t seen Alice for ages = It’s ages since I last saw Alice ( SINCE + PAST SIMPLE)
2. 2. She started to teach 13 years ago = She has taught for 13 years
3. 3. We last visited Rome three years ago = We haven’t visited Rome for three years
4. It’s 3 months since she last phoned me = The last time she phoned me was three months ago ( LAST
TIME + PAST SIMPLE)
5. Peter has never heard classical music before = It’s the first time Peter has heard classical music
(FIRST TIME + PRESENT PERFECT)
6. 6. This is the silliest joke I have ever heard = I have never heard such a silly joke before
7. 7. I arrived in London last week and I’m still here = I have been in London for a week.
8. 8. When did you meet Antonio? = How long have you known Antonio?
